
People read a local newspaper during the annual El Pilon bull run in Falces, northern Spain, Thursday Aug. 19, 2010. The paper tells of 40 people injured Wednesday in nearby Tafalla, in the northern region of Navarra, when a bull leapt over a fence at a bullfight and climbed up the stairs of the stands knocking over people, including young children. The incident comes at a time when the country is split over whether bullfighting should be completely outlawed. (AP Photo/Alvaro Barrientos)
